A leading insurer is looking to add an Accident and Health Claims Handler to their established Glasgow team. On offer is the chance to work in a progressive and forward-thinking environment, allowing technical skills to be honed over time.

What will the day-to-day look like?

  • Accurately assessing and evaluating complex claims, reserve calculations and settlement values
  • Dealing with incoming call enquiries effectively
  • Providing a professional service to customers
  • Identifying complaints and recognise customer expressions of dissatisfaction
  • Maintaining and developing technical knowledge and expertise
  • Maintaining key client relationships with regard to specific customers and accounts, for issues such as: late notification of claims, case progress, and issuing specific insured requirements within SLAs
  • Escalating relevant client issues to senior team members and management as required

What experience is needed?

  • Claim handling experience, preferably from within a Broker or Insurance Office
  • Customer services experience demonstrating a professional standard in customer care
  • Experience of prioritising and working to SLAs
  • Strong listening & communication skills
  • A process-minded, adaptable and customer-focused attitude
